.page_careersPage__QqI3Q{min-height:100vh;padding-top:calc(var(--spacing-xl) + 80px);padding-bottom:var(--spacing-xl)}.page_pageHeader__RxiY3{max-width:1400px;margin:0 auto var(--spacing-xl);padding:0 var(--spacing-md)}.page_label__yM4Ru{display:block;font-family:var(--font-mono);font-size:var(--font-size-xs);text-transform:uppercase;letter-spacing:.1em;color:var(--color-text-muted);margin-bottom:var(--spacing-xs)}.page_title__EEuAW{font-family:var(--font-display);font-size:var(--font-size-hero);text-transform:uppercase;margin-bottom:var(--spacing-md)}.page_title__EEuAW .page_highlight__OtXzy{color:var(--color-accent-maroon)}.page_intro__MWSbi{font-family:var(--font-body);font-size:var(--font-size-md);color:var(--color-text-muted);max-width:600px}.page_blinkingCursor__o6XmP{animation:page_blink__2Xa72 1s step-end infinite}@keyframes page_blink__2Xa72{0%,to{opacity:1}50%{opacity:0}}.page_formContainer__8DVWy{max-width:900px;margin:0 auto;padding:0 var(--spacing-md)}.page_applicationForm__ebDw4{background-color:var(--color-bg-primary);padding:var(--spacing-lg);border:1px solid rgba(13,13,14,.1);border-radius:var(--radius-md)}.page_formTitle__5r10w{font-family:var(--font-display);font-size:var(--font-size-xl);text-transform:uppercase;margin-bottom:var(--spacing-lg);padding-bottom:var(--spacing-sm);border-bottom:1px solid rgba(13,13,14,.1)}.page_formGroup__zLfOt{margin-bottom:var(--spacing-md)}.page_formLabel__qioTC{display:block;font-family:var(--font-mono);font-size:var(--font-size-xs);text-transform:uppercase;letter-spacing:.05em;color:var(--color-text-muted);margin-bottom:var(--spacing-xs)}.page_formInput__Ib_Bv,.page_formTextarea__pGTSP{width:100%;font-family:var(--font-body);font-size:var(--font-size-base);padding:var(--spacing-sm);border:1px solid rgba(13,13,14,.2);border-radius:var(--radius-sm);background-color:var(--color-bg-primary);transition:border-color var(--transition-fast)}.page_formInput__Ib_Bv:focus,.page_formTextarea__pGTSP:focus{outline:none;border-color:var(--color-accent-maroon)}.page_formInput__Ib_Bv::placeholder,.page_formTextarea__pGTSP::placeholder{color:var(--color-text-muted)}.page_formTextarea__pGTSP{resize:vertical;min-height:100px}.page_formGrid__yF8DJ{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:var(--spacing-md);gap:var(--spacing-md)}.page_fileUpload__MgOEc{margin-bottom:var(--spacing-md)}.page_fileInputWrapper__4icC4{position:relative;display:flex;flex-direction:column;gap:var(--spacing-xs)}.page_fileInput__yhGNi{width:100%;padding:var(--spacing-sm);border:2px dashed rgba(13,13,14,.2);border-radius:var(--radius-sm);background-color:transparent;cursor:pointer;transition:all var(--transition-fast)}.page_fileInput__yhGNi:hover{border-color:var(--color-accent-maroon)}.page_fileHint__gQfHt{font-family:var(--font-mono);font-size:var(--font-size-xs);color:var(--color-text-muted)}.page_uploadProgress__hBnTh,.page_uploadedFile__VgI4y{display:flex;align-items:center;gap:var(--spacing-xs);font-family:var(--font-mono);font-size:var(--font-size-xs);color:var(--color-accent-maroon)}.page_uploadedFile__VgI4y{padding:var(--spacing-xs) var(--spacing-sm);background-color:rgba(156,54,100,.1);border-radius:var(--radius-sm)}.page_consent__Kmzvw{font-family:var(--font-mono);font-size:var(--font-size-xs);color:var(--color-text-muted);margin-bottom:var(--spacing-md)}.page_submitButton__Xf5eI{width:100%;padding:var(--spacing-sm) var(--spacing-md);background-color:var(--color-bg-secondary);color:var(--color-text-secondary);font-family:var(--font-mono);font-size:var(--font-size-sm);text-transform:uppercase;letter-spacing:.1em;border:none;border-radius:var(--radius-pill);cursor:pointer;transition:all var(--transition-base)}.page_submitButton__Xf5eI:hover:not(:disabled){background-color:var(--color-accent-maroon);transform:translateY(-2px)}.page_submitButton__Xf5eI:disabled{opacity:.7;cursor:not-allowed}.page_errorMessage__f0QZC{font-family:var(--font-mono);font-size:var(--font-size-xs);color:#ef4444;margin-top:var(--spacing-sm);text-align:center}.page_successMessage__QWm2P{text-align:center;padding:var(--spacing-xl)}.page_successTitle__2VhkT{font-family:var(--font-display);font-size:var(--font-size-xl);text-transform:uppercase;margin-bottom:var(--spacing-sm);color:var(--color-accent-maroon)}.page_successText__5pSmR{font-family:var(--font-body);font-size:var(--font-size-base);color:var(--color-text-muted);margin-bottom:var(--spacing-md)}.page_resetButton__Kl35L{padding:var(--spacing-xs) var(--spacing-md);background:transparent;border:2px solid var(--color-text-primary);border-radius:var(--radius-pill);font-family:var(--font-mono);font-size:var(--font-size-xs);text-transform:uppercase;letter-spacing:.05em;cursor:pointer;transition:all var(--transition-base)}.page_resetButton__Kl35L:hover{background-color:var(--color-text-primary);color:var(--color-bg-primary)}@media (max-width:768px){.page_formGrid__yF8DJ{grid-template-columns:1fr}.page_applicationForm__ebDw4{padding:var(--spacing-md)}}@media (max-width:576px){.page_careersPage__QqI3Q{padding-top:calc(var(--spacing-lg) + 60px)}}